Gumberg, Cunningham Lead Cats in Day Two of Tavistock

ISLEWORTH, FLA. – The University of Arizona Men's Golf team completed the second round of the Tavistock Collegiate Invitational, ending the day in 11th place with a score of 592 (+16) after two of three rounds played.

"Today was another up and down day," commented head men's golf coach Jim Anderson. "I am very proud of the composure we are demonstrating and tomorrow we need to improve on some strategy decisions. Our opening nine holes were very good and we had it under par through the turn. A few mistakes, including four doubles were counted today, so we need to remain patient even if we are over par tomorrow. Finishing strong is important and we slipped at the end today. I think the guys know we are close and maybe got a little ahead of themselves at the end. If we stay patient, we can post a great score in final round and move up the board. The team has improved since the beginning of year and we are going to be ready tomorrow."

The Wildcats recorded 17 birdies in day two of the competition, and three of the five Cats competing birdied the 573 yard par 5 seventh hole.

Leading the Cats in day two of the competition were juniors Jordan Gumberg and George Cunningham. Gumberg shot par on the day, recording four of his six birdies in round two. The Fort Lauderdale native three consecutive birdies on holes 13, 14, and 15. Cunningham shot a 76 (+4) on the day. The pair of juniors sit tied for 31st with a score of 147 (+3) going into the final day of competition.

"I felt good today," commented Gumberg, "everything was clicking. I just need to keep hitting the ball in the center of the greens to really give myself a chance. The golf course is in great shape, we just need to stay focused and see if we can climb up the leaderboard and knock off some of these top ranked teams."

Junior Ethan Marcus and freshman David Laskin end the second day of play in a tie for 51st place with a score of 151 (+7). Marcus shot a 73 (+1) on the day and Laskin recorded a 78 (+6).

Senior Redford Bobbitt is tied for 56th with a score of 152 (+8).

The Wildcats tee off tomorrow at 5:25 a.m. MST.
